Driveway Drainage Repair in Birmingham, AL
Driveway drainage repair services focus on fixing issues related to water runoff and pooling that can occur along residential driveways. These projects typically involve identifying areas where water collects or flows improperly, and then implementing solutions such as installing or repairing drainage channels, grading the driveway surface, or adding drainage systems like catch basins or French drains. Property owners may request this service when experiencing frequent puddling, erosion, or water damage that affects the driveway’s stability and appearance, especially after heavy rains or seasonal changes.
Homeowners interested in driveway drainage repair should understand the importance of proper water management to prevent long-term damage. It’s helpful to consider the driveway’s current slope, drainage patterns, and any existing drainage infrastructure. Before requesting repairs, property owners often want to know if the issues are caused by poor grading, clogged or damaged drains, or other structural problems. Addressing these concerns can help ensure effective solutions that improve water flow and protect the driveway’s integrity.

Driveway Drainage Repair Questions
What causes driveway drainage problems? Poor grading, clogged drains, and compacted soil can lead to water pooling or runoff issues on driveways.
How can drainage issues affect a driveway? Excess water can cause cracks, erosion, and settling, leading to damage and reduced lifespan.
What signs indicate a need for driveway drainage repair? Standing water, cracks, or uneven surfaces are common indicators of drainage problems.
What types of repair options are available for driveway drainage? Solutions include regrading, installing drains, or adding gravel to improve water flow away from the driveway.
